The Cock Inn, Leek

This place has obviously changed drastically again since the last review [2 1/2 years back]. Now taken over by new micro brewery Joules [reviving the name of the pub's original brewery] and given a serious 'traditional pub' makeover. Lots of fuittings and furnishings from the old Joules brewery. When I was there a few days ago, the very friendly barman explained that the new Joules Brewery isn't quite up-and-running yet, so I'll have wait to see what their ale is like; in the meantime, always at least three other real ales, no 'smooth' though if that's what you're after. I arrived just as a disappointed customer was leaving having been unable to get a pint of the aforementioned chemical soup. Bad news for her, great news for me.

Barley Mow, Leicester

Been visiting this pub on & off for 20 years, whenever travelling to & Leicester by train as it's close to the station. Hasn't changed much in that time; well-kept Everard's + guest - good pint of White Horse today - always a good place to relax; take the point about the sofas, which seem to have strayed in from a different boozer and yes, as my partner pointed out, it is something of a 'lads' pub, but worth a visit if you've some time to kill before catching your train; also handy for a pint before a meal in Halli, the excellent Indian restaurant two doors up.
